A new Wilkinson power divider with ±45° phase shifts at two bands for dual-frequency operation is studied in this paper. Studies show that the phase shift can be controlled by the characteristic impedances of transmission lines of a π-shaped network, as compared with the conventional case. Moreover, by optimally determining the characteristic impedances, flat phase responses, thus widened bandwidths, can be achieved at the two bands. Analysis of the π-shaped network is performed and corresponding design considerations are given. Demonstration on a 2.4/5.2-GHz dual-band power divider with, respectively, +45° and - 45° phase shifts at the two bands verifies the analyses well.
